mercurial

    1热度

    1回答

    是否有可能使版本控制存储库在本地网络中使用SourceTree或Mercurial进行使用。没有找到任何相关的信息。这完全可能只用lan吗?

    0热度

    1回答

    我收到了文件列表,a和b和x/y。我们的目标是有以下的输出: revision1 a revision2 b revision1 x/y 每个文件改版前是最后的修订,改变这个文件。无法弄清楚,有没有一个可以做到这一点的命令?谢谢! 我想避免的事情是100个单独的命令100个文件,这将是如此缓慢。

    2热度

    2回答

    试图做同样的事情在这里:你在哪里新hgignore文件应用到已经提交的文件Applying .gitignore to committed files 。 我有node_modules文件夹已经提交了数千个文件,我想通过使用新的hgignore文件将其删除。 我在网上找不到任何东西可以用于Mercurial回购,任何想法?谢谢!

    0热度

    1回答

    怎样才能迅速地重新设置父级树在水银等,如果这是原来的结构: A-B-C-D-E-F 我想将它更改为: D-E-F(甚至A-D-E-F会做) 我试着在this answer的建议与splicemap,但它失败,错误splice map revision <hash> is not being converted, ignoring' 它也打印出来abort: no node! 任何帮助将appric

    0热度

    1回答

    tortoisehg中的设置在代码预览中更改选项卡大小。默认情况下,它设置为8,查看选项卡式源代码不太舒服。

    1热度

    1回答

    添加存储库后,会弹出一个标题为“git凭证管理器”窗口的窗口。 无论我做什么(输入不同的登录名和密码,取消),它会再次出现。并在两个以上的副本。 如何摆脱它? 我在.hgrc文件中注册了以下设置,但这没有帮助。 [auth] repo.prefix = http://to.my.repo repo.username = <login> repo.password = <pass> repo

    0热度

    1回答

    我在Mac上设置Jenkins,并使用Mercurial(Hg)。 Jenkins和Hg均已安装。我可以从命令行运行Hg。 它位于/ usr/local/bin目录 我用过的詹金斯全球工具来设置汞的位置。我已经试过安装目录和可执行文件的各种组合来指定该路径。 他们都没有工作。 在/ usr /本地安装/斌/ HG 在/ usr/local/bin目录和汞 空白和/ usr/local/bin目录/

    2热度

    1回答

    我在Linux上使用Mercurial 3.1.2。我有2个分支:default和stable。 总是当我改变分支我看到通知说,文件已更新尽管据我所知分支应该处于相同的状态。 (我只是合并和运行hg up之前提交它们。) hg up default 1 files updated, 0 files merged, 0 files removed, 0 files unresolved 我看不

    0热度

    2回答

    我试图找出如果下面的Mercurial命令是等价的(附加+旁id -i输出,如果目录已经修改过的文件):hg id -i和hg log -l1 --template "{node|short}"。他们还是不是? 其目的是为了加速某些自动化,而不需要执行id -i并在log模板中使用{node|short}。他们似乎相当,但我宁愿如果别人看看,以及我继续前。

    0热度

    1回答

    我有两个Mercurial存储库。两个回购都有自己无关的历史。让我们称他们为: “主”(包括项目本身) 我现在想“进口”的Lab回购到 “实验室”(包含一些相关内容) Main具有以下限制的回购: 两个回购都应保留其历史。 Lab应作为子文件夹存储在Main中。 Lab的更改应位于合并到Main的分支中。 以下https://www.mercurial-scm.org/wiki/MergingUn